Genes affected
TRAPPC3 (HGNC:19942): (trafficking protein particle complex subunit 3) This gene encodes a component of the trafficking protein particle complex, which tethers transport vesicles to the cis-Golgi membrane. The encoded protein participates in the regulation of transport from the endoplasmic reticulum to the Golgi apparatus. Alternative splicing results in multiple transcript variants.
